Millennials are projected to become the wealthiest generation in history (again). Millennials are predicted to inherit significant property assets from preceding gens, leading to a “seismic” increase in wealth over the next two decades. This transfer of wealth amounts to $90T is the U.S. alone, marking a substantial shift in wealth distribution between gens. Liam Bailey, global head of research at Knight Frank, suggests that this shift in wealth dynamics could encourage sustainable investments and behavior among Millennials, who are increasingly conscious of reducing their carbon footprints. (The Guardian)

🔎 ​​​YPulse reported: Other studies suggest the Great Boomer Wealth Transfer is unlikely to benefit most Millennials
